Abstract

PURPOSE:To simultaneously record two television signals with one device and to select one of the television signals at the time of reproducing by obtaining a reproducing television signal from the output of a second switch and the output of the third switch. CONSTITUTION:A recording and reproducing device equips input terminals 16-19, a video signal synchronizing circuit 20, switches 21, 23 and 24, a delay circuit 22, pseudo-vertical synchronizing signal inserting circuit 25 and input terminals 26 and 27. A part to be surrounded by a broken line is same as the conventional VTR of a VHS system. The reproducing television signal is obtained from the output of the second switch 23 and the output of the third switch 24. Thus, only by a little circuit to the conventional VTR, the VTR can be obtained to record the two television signals simultaneously with one device and to select one of the television signals at the time of the reproducing.

In FIG. 2, a video signal consisting of a luminance signal and a color signal is input from an input terminal 1. Video signal recording processing circuit 4
The luminance signal and the color signal are frequency-converted and frequency-multiplexed into an FM luminance signal and a low frequency converted color signal, and then recorded on the magnetic tape 10 via the switch 6 and the magnetic head 8. On the other hand, the stereo audio signals inputted from the input terminals 2 and 3 are converted into FM audio signals by the audio signal recording processing circuit 5.
The data is recorded on the magnetic tape 1o via the switch 7 and the magnetic head 9. Here, the FM audio signal has a longer wavelength than the FM brightness signal and -9'' degree signal, and is recorded on the tape exploration section.
Since the M luminance signal has a short wavelength, it is recorded on the surface layer of the tape. In addition, since the low frequency conversion color signal is recorded at a low recording level, it is recorded on the surface layer and does not affect the audio much.

The operation of the T/TR configured as described above will be described below. The first and second video signals are input to the input terminals 16 and 18, respectively, and the video signal synchronization circuit 2

The first video signal is then supplied to the video signal recording processing circuit 4 for even fields and the second video signal for odd fields. - side, input terminals 17 and 19
The first and second monaural audio signals are respectively supplied from the audio signal recording processing circuit 5 to the audio signal recording processing circuit 5.

During playback, the video signal playback processing device 11 outputs the first and second signals.
video signals are output alternately for each field. (L
L) The first video signal is transmitted to the delay circuit 22 and the switch 2 in the even field, and the second video signal is transmitted in the odd field.
3. The delay circuit 22 converts the video signal into 2e2H (
1H is delayed by one horizontal scanning time) and is supplied to the switch 23. (b) The switch 23 is a for each field.
b is alternately selected and output. Here, the first video signal can be obtained by controlling the switch 23 so that a is selected in the even field and b is selected in the odd field.

Conversely, if the switch 23 is controlled so that b is selected for even fields and a is selected for odd fields, a second video signal is obtained. After a pseudo vertical synchronizing signal is inserted into the output of the switch 23 by a pseudo vertical synchronizing signal insertion circuit 25,
It is output from the output terminal 26. On the other hand, the first and second monaural audio signals are supplied from the audio signal reproduction processing circuit 12 to the switch 24 , one of which is selected by the switch 24 and outputted from the output terminal 27 .
